Now, let’s break it down a bit. A steam towel that’s warm but not hot serves a dual purpose. Firstly, it enhances client relaxation. Think about those times when you've had a warm towel draped across your face—so comforting, right? That warmth soothes muscles and eases tension, making it an essential part of any grooming service worth its salt.

Secondly, there’s the skincare element. When the towel is just the right temperature, it helps to cleanse the skin, opening those pores and softening facial hair before a shave. You know what that means? A smoother shave with less irritation for your clients! Who wouldn’t want that?

While cool towels might sound refreshing, they simply don’t provide the benefits you get from a warm towel. Cool ones might even leave your clients feeling more tense, which is the opposite of what you want. And room temperature towels? Well, they can be effective for certain applications, but they lack the luxury feeling that a warm towel contributes to the experience.
